The women in Saudi Arabia they finally can drive
Saudi Arabia announces women will be given right to drive* | Daily Mail Online
In a landmark move Saudi Arabia's King Salman has given women in the Kingdom the right to drive with the royal order set to come into force on June 24 next year.
There has been social change in the country in recent weeks. On Saturday, hundreds of women thronged a sports stadium for the first time to mark Saudi Arabia's national day.
King Salman issued an order easing male guardianship rules this year, allowing women to benefit from government services such as education and healthcare. Previously they needed male consent to access such services.
Saudi Arabias Vision 2030 is aimed at improving the quality of life of its citizens and expatriates through better efficiencies, the adoption of new technology and innovation.
